Inherited duplications of <i>PPP2R3B</i> promote naevi and melanoma via a novel <i>C21orf91</i> -driven proliferative phenotype

2019-06-15

Abstract excerpt

The majority of the heredity of melanoma remains unexplained, however inherited copy number changes have not yet been systematically studied. The genetic environment is highly relevant to treatment stratification, and new gene discovery is therefore desirable. Using an unbiased whole genome screening approach for copy number we identify here a novel melanoma predisposing factor, familial duplications of gene PPP2...
